Our client specialises in manufacturing different gearing systems. They are looking for someone to program, set, and operate Electrical Discharge Machines (EDM), Makino wire machines, in line with engineering drawings and customer specifications. The role ensures machines are correctly prepared, tooling is optimised, and components are produced efficiently while maintaining the highest standards of quality and safety.
Key Responsibilities:
Program, set and operate wire erosion in-line with engineering drawings and specifications
Interpret engineering drawings in both metric and imperial units to manufacture high-precision components within tight tolerances
Download, validate, and optimise CNC/EDM programs to maximise efficiency and accuracy
Select, set up, and secure tooling, fixtures, and workpieces appropriately
Carry out trial runs, inspect first-off parts, and perform in-process inspections to ensure adherence to quality standards
Adjust machine settings, offsets, and tooling to maintain accuracy and meet production targets
Organise and prioritise tasks in line with production schedules and operational demands
Assist with prototype, development, and tooling projects, including the manufacture and modification of fixtures
Rectify or rework non-conforming parts to meet specifications, while supporting tool repair and refurbishment to reduce downtime
Perform routine maintenance on EDM equipment, including cleaning, dielectric checks, and wire/electrode handling
Ensure machines are fully supplied with necessary consumables such as wire, electrodes, dielectric fluids, and tooling
Skills and Qualifications/experience:
Time-served engineer or equivalent experience within a precision engineering environment
Proven experience in wire erosion and/or spark erosion, including programming and
operating EDM Makino machinery
Strong understanding of engineering drawings, geometric tolerances, and working to tight
tolerances on precision components
Solid knowledge of manufacturing processes, tooling, materials, and inspection methods
Familiar with NADCAP requirements
Good awareness of quality standards and health & safety regulations within a manufacturing environment
